Notice of proposed rulemaking (NPRM).

We propose to revise an existing airworthiness directive (AD) that applies to TAE models TAE 125-01 and TAE 125-02-99 reciprocating engines installed on, but not limited to, Diamond Aircraft Industries Model DA 42 airplanes. The existing AD currently requires initial and repetitive replacements of proportional pressure reducing valves (PPRVs) (also known as propeller control valves). Since we issued that AD, TAE has increased the life of the PPRV, part number (P/N) 05-7212- E002801, on TAE 125-02-99 engines, from 300 hours to 600 hours. This proposed AD would relax the repetitive replacement interval from a 300- hour interval to a 600-hour interval for PPRVs, P/N 05-7212-E002801, on TAE 125-02-99 engines. We are proposing this AD to prevent engine in- flight shutdown, possibly resulting in reduced control of the aircraft.
